1. Check If Reels Are Available in Your Country

Before going through the other troubleshooting steps, confirm the feature is available in your country. This way, you don’t try fixing a problem that doesn’t exist.

If you’re not sure the feature is available where you live, you can checkInstagram’s support pagefor a list of countries where Reels ads are supported. Where these ads are supported, Reels are available to users.

Are Instagram Reels Not Available in Your Region?

If Instagram hasn’t yet made the Reels feature available in your region, there’s a trick for you to try.

You could try using a VPN and set your virtual location to a country where Reels are available. If you own an Android device, there are a fewfree VPN services available for Android. Keep in mind that you should connect to the VPN every time you open Instagram if you don’t want Instagram Reels to disappear.

2. Check Your Internet Connection

If you’re able to’t watch Instagram Reels on your phone, there might be a problem with your internet connection, especially if you see the message: “Couldn’t refresh feed”.

You can try to reconnect to the network and check if this fixes the problem. However, if there are a lot of devices sharing the same network, you may be dealing with slow internet speed.

It might be worth it toreset your routerand see if that fixes your connectivity issues.

4. Update Instagram to the Latest Version

Using an outdated Instagram version might be the reason why Reels are not working. To update the app to the latest available version, launch the Apple App Store or Google Play Store, search for Instagram, and tap theUpdatebutton.

5. Update Your Device

Another reason why you can’t watch Instagram reels is an outdated OS version. If other apps or features are malfunctioning as well, you should manually revise your phone.

On an Android device, go toSettings > Software update,and tapDownloadand install. Then, choose if you want to update your device now or schedule to update.

To update an iPad or iPhone, head toSettings > Generaland selectSoftware Update.

6. Log Out and Log Back In

If updating the app didn’t make Reels available, logging out and logging back into your Instagram account is another quick fix you can try. Launch Instagram and tap your profile icon from the bottom-right corner. Then, head toSettingsand tapLog Out.

Now, log in with your credentials and check if Instagram Reels are available.

7. Turn Off Instagram’s Data Saver

Instagram has a data saver feature that will stop content from loading in advance. While it may have a positive impact on your data usage, Instagram Reels will take longer to start playing. But if you’ve exceeded your internet data plan, your phone will stop playing Instagram Reels.

8. Switch to Instagram Lite

If you constantly have to clear your phone and Instagram’s cached data, you should switch to Instagram Lite.

Instagram Lite doesn’t take that much space on your phone and uses less mobile data. While there are somedifferences between Instagram and Instagram Lite, you can still watch Reels on the Lite version.

At the time of writing, Instagram Lite is available only for Android phones.

11. Try The Instagram Beta

If you still can’t watch reels on Instagram Lite, there’s one more version that you could try. On the Instagram Beta, you’ll get early access to upcoming versions, which might fix the issue. At the time of writing, Instagram Beta is available only on the Google Play Store, so it’s available only for Android owners.

Go toInstagram Beta’s pageand apply to become a tester. Then, you should receive an update to the Instagram app.

While installing Instagram Beta might fix the inability to watch Instagram Reels, you should keep in mind the early version might experience bugs or frequent crashes. Unfortunately, you can’t have Instagram and Instagram Beta running simultaneously on the same device.

What to Do If Instagram Reels Sound Isn’t Working

Most of the time, Instagram Reels have no sound because the creator muted the audio, possibly as an artisticway for their Instagram account to stand outor because they prefer to not use sound. If you scroll down to the next Reel, and it has audio, there’s nothing wrong with the app or with your phone.
